Little area heating units are typically made use of when the primary heating unit is not available, insufficient, or when central heating is too expensive to set up or run. Sometimes, tiny room heaters can be less costly to utilize if you only intend to warmth one space or supplement inadequate heating in one area.


Little room heating systems function by convection (the blood circulation of air in a room) or glowing heating. Glowing heaters release infrared radiation that straight heats up objects and individuals within their view, and are an extra efficient option when you will certainly be in an area for just a few hours and can remain within the line of view of the heating unit.

Security is a top consideration when using tiny room heating systems. When buying and installing a tiny area heater, adhere to these guidelines: Newer model tiny area heating units have present safety and security functions.

Pick a thermostatically managed heater, because they prevent the energy waste of overheating a room. Select a heating system of the proper dimension for the room you desire to warmth. Do not purchase large heating systems. Most heating units include a general sizing table. Situate the heating unit on a level surface area far from foot web traffic.

There are various other factors to consider to take into account in determining whether a room heater is appropriate for you.


The only circumstance in which an area heater is environmentally friendly or energy reliable is when it's used to minimize the quantity of energy a main home heating system makes use of. For instance, if you work from home, using a room heater can be an excellent method to maintain your workplace comfy without warming the unused rooms in the remainder of the residence.


In general, one square foot of space requires about 10 watts of electrical energy to warm, which indicates that a space heater operating at its optimal outcome can warm a room no larger than 150 square feet. 1 Source Portable Air. According to the National Fire Security Organization, room heating units and heating stoves was accountable for the biggest shares of losses in home heating equipment fires from 2018-2022, making up nearly fifty percent of the fires

DO select a room heating system with built-in safety and security functions (much more on this later). DON'T leave a room heating system running when you aren't in the room, and never leave it on over night.

DON'T make use of an expansion cord or power strip with an electric area heater. It can trigger the device to get too hot and provides a tripping risk. DO keep the room heating system far from combustible items (3 feet is an excellent guideline). DON'T run a room heating system's cable under check this carpeting or furnishings, which can raise the threat of fire.


DON'T utilize an area heater if the cord seems harmed or is hot to the touch. DO area the space heating unit on a hard, level, nonflammable surface area. While it's vital to just run room heating systems each time and in a location where they can be monitored by an accountable adult, there are a variety of security features that can give you additional assurance.

Automatic shut-off in the occasion of getting too hot. A thermostat that keeps track of the indoor temperature. Independent qualification (such as UL) shows that the item has actually been tested and meets specific scientific security, top quality, or safety and security criteria. Cool-touch housing, to avoid unintentional contact burns. Multiple temperature settings will enable you to pick the most affordable temperature for your requirements, so you're not paying even more to overheat your room.

If you're questioning if an area heater might be a great option for you, take into consideration these benefits and negative aspects before you dedicate. Making use of a space heating unit appropriately can be a terrific way to save cash. Room heating systems heat only the location where they're placed. You placed one in the room you're currently utilizing and it heats that room, usually via convection (or circulationthe same method cooling and heating warms).

An area heating unit use significantly much less power than a heating and cooling going for the same temperature level, which will certainly assist you save cash on power. You can save more by rejecting your heating and cooling's check thermostat while you have the area heating system on. You stay equally as cozy, yet you're not throwing away power home heating spaces you aren't utilizing.
